The BEng Mechatronics and Autonomous Systems programme teaches students how to design and control smart machines and robotics by combining mechanical and electrical engineering, computing, and control systems. Students will learn how to create complex automated systems by learning about robotics, electronics, and software development.
Students will learn through lectures, practical laboratory sessions, and project-based work and will be assessed through written examinations, coursework reports, a portfolio of work, and a final-year project. The curriculum includes core modules such as Engineering Mathematics 1a and 1b, Applied Mechanics, Software Development for Embedded, Engineering Circuit Analysis, Analogue Electronics, and Professional Practice and the Environment.

The annual tuition fee for the BEng Mechatronics and Autonomous Systems course at Liverpool John Moores University for the 2025/26 academic year is £18,250.
Liverpool John Moores University offers Scholarships to International students, such as the International Achievement Scholarship, which gives them a £4,000 discount on tuition fees. It is automatic for eligible students and applies every year. To qualify, students need to fund themselves, meet their offer conditions and not have other external funding.
LJMU offers sports scholarships to talented athletes, providing them with financial support, expert guidance, and flexible study arrangements to help them balance training and studies. They also offer a £500 discount to international students who pay their tuition fees early.
